Across TCGA pan-cancer cohorts, SLC29A3 RNA is linked to patient survival in 25 of 34 cancer types, making it the most broadly survival-associated SLC29A3 data layer compared with 2 for mutation status and 3 for mass-spec protein.

The strongest signal is observed in liver hepatocellular carcinoma (LIHC), where higher SLC29A3 RNA is associated with worse overall survival. In most high-consensus cancer types, elevated SLC29A3 expression acts as an unfavorable survival marker, although some lineages such as SKCM and DLBC show a favorable association.

LIHC, SKCM, and DLBC are the cancer types where SLC29A3 RNA most reproducibly stratifies survival.
